Understanding Database Performance Monitoring: The BasicsSeptember 28, 2020 No Comments
By Robert Ashford, Independent Technology Author
In the world of IT, database performance monitoring is a term you’ll hear bandied around a lot. While you’ll likely know that it can have a notably positive impact on your business, the average person is unlikely to fully comprehend what it is or how it works.
If this statement rings true for you, you’ll benefit from reading this article. Designed to give you a basic understanding of what database performance monitoring is and how it could be useful, it should provide a handy springboard for performing some further research of your own.
Here’s what you need to know.
What is database performance monitoring?
Database performance monitoring is a rather convoluted term, but its definition is reasonably simple: it’s the act of measuring how well a database is working. It can provide real-time updates to help you get to the root of any problems or potential issues.
As well as allowing you to identify these, database monitoring can also be used to optimize performance overall, by pointing you toward areas where efficiency can be improved. Typically, this is achieved through various types of monitoring software, which is either built into the system itself or comes from a third party.
An example of the latter would be the Database Performance Monitor from SolarWinds. Designed to track the performance of databases either in the cloud or locally, this uses real-time and historical data to pinpoint any performance issues. Offering various tools to help users do this, it’s primarily designed to make the process simpler and more streamlined.
How does database performance monitoring work?
As we explained above, the overarching goal of database performance monitoring is to pinpoint problems and provide the tools for solving these, while also actively improving overall functionality and efficiency.
This allows administrators to use various options and interfaces in order to gather information that they can utilize. It’s possible to both monitor the system as a whole and to study various portions specifically, depending on what one wishes to achieve.
The primary aim of database performance monitoring is to evaluate how the database’s server is performing, in terms of both its hardware and its software. To do this, the system will usually take regular ‘snapshots’ of various performance indicators, so it can assess exactly when and how issues arise.
For example, bottlenecks, which are a frequent problem with databases, can occur at any time, so asking an administrator to manually monitor performance often proves ineffective as a means of identifying problems and finding a solution. When historical data is also taken into account, however, as in the case of database performance monitoring, it’s much simpler to work out what went wrong and why.
Not only this, but the alarms and notification systems that are often built into these systems mean that it’s sometimes possible to spot potential issues even before they develop into a full-blown problem.
What are the benefits of database performance monitoring?
As we’ve covered in the sections above, database performance monitoring offers some useful insights to administrators, but it also does much more than this. Its benefits are numerous and multifaceted, and include:
- The ability to identify whether and how performance can be enhanced;
- The ability to pinpoint performance and/or security issues by assessing application and user activity;
- Access to tools that can be used for troubleshooting and debugging, so that problems can not only be identified, but resolved quickly and easily in-house.
Tell us, would database performance monitoring be of benefit to your business?APPLICATION INTEGRATION, DATA and ANALYTICS , SECURITY, SOCIAL BUSINESS